§63-2211. Donor notation on driver license.

63 OK Stat § 63-2211 (2019) (N/A)
Copy with citation
Copy as parenthetical citation

In order to provide an expeditious procedure for a person to make a gift of all or part of the body of the person pursuant to the provisions of the Uniform Anatomical Gift Act, the Department of Public Safety shall make space available on the front and back of the driver license and the identification card for an organ and tissue donor notation. The donor notation shall identify the licensee or cardholder as an organ and tissue donor for the purposes of the Uniform Anatomical Gift Act. Any person may have the organ and tissue donor notation removed from the records of the person maintained by the Department by notifying the Department in writing or by presenting the license or identification card to the Department or a motor license agent for replacement and payment of the appropriate fee, pursuant to the provisions of Section 6-114 or subsection H of Section 6-105 of Title 47 of the Oklahoma Statutes, and informing the Department or motor license agent that the person desires to have the organ and tissue donor notation removed from the license or identification card.

Added by Laws 1983, c. 173, § 1, eff. Jan. 1, 1984. Amended by Laws 1987, c. 2, § 1, eff. Nov. 1, 1987; Laws 1992, c. 217, § 18, eff. July 1, 1992; Laws 2004, c. 395, § 3, eff. July 1, 2004.
